I'm sorry but the seller doesn't need to respond to you at all,have you heard of auto decline offers,a seller has this in place and therefore doesn't need to deal with a buyer.

And I'm confused as how you put in a bid on an auction and then received a counter offer???

When a seller has a buy it now and make an offer then when you make an offer the seller can accept it or not without having to let you know by automatically declining your offer.

Do you mean you put in a Best Offer? If so sensible sellers have their listings set to auto accept or reject bids above or below the price range they will accept, they wouldn't even know you had made an offer if it was too low. Many sellers have hundreds of items for sale, sometimes across multiple ids so would not have time to do anything else but reply personally to emails. If you are after a pen friend try the social media sites but ebay transactions are a business relationship and nothing more.
